Q. If \( a^{b^c} = 256 \), find maximum value of \( abc \)
(a) 12 (b) 16 (c) 32 (d) 256
✏️ Solution
\( 256 = 2^8 \)
Possible forms: \( a^{b^c} = 2^8 \)
Take \( a = 2 \Rightarrow b^c = 8 \)
Maximize \( bc \): \( 8 = 2^3 \Rightarrow b = 2,\ c = 3 \)
\( abc = 2 \cdot 2 \cdot 3 = 12 \)
Try better: \( a = 4 = 2^2 \Rightarrow (4)^{b^c} = 2^8 \Rightarrow b^c = 4 \)
\( 4 = 2^2 \Rightarrow b = 2,\ c = 2 \)
\( abc = 4 \cdot 2 \cdot 2 = 16 \)
Try \( a = 16 = 2^4 \Rightarrow b^c = 2 \)
\( b = 2,\ c = 1 \Rightarrow abc = 16 \cdot 2 \cdot 1 = 32 \)
Maximum = 32
Correct Option: (c) 32
